What Are The Chances Of Having A Miscarriage With Low HCG Levels And Spotting?

Hi there, last week I was 7 weeks pregnant and HCG levels measured 3090. Over two days they had only increased by 33% to 4100. I had a scan at 7 weeks and all we could see was the sack. My GP has said she isn t hopeful that the pregnancy will last at this stage. I have had minor spotting (now at 8 weeks) but it is brown and very light (I actually had the same with my first baby at 8 weeks, so around the time my period would normally have been due). I am expecting to have a miscarriage and having a scan at 9 weeks to test viability. Are there any stats around how commonly this turns into a successful pregnancy?
